Dusty residents report on holiday gatherings

Dusty

Guests for Christmas dinner at the Dick Appel home were Deb, Bob, Alyssa and Scot Stavig, Brush Prairie; Jessica and Kyle Wanke, Ridgefield; Eric, Shannon, Connor, Christopher, Sarah, Kyle and Sidney Appel, Dusty; Steve and Dianne Appel, Dusty; Dave, Alice and Charlie Appel, Colfax; Lois Scholz, Colfax, and Phil and Sabrina Appel, Spokane. Arriving to join the Stavigs, Wankes, and Phil Appel on Dec. 26 for hog butchering were Barb, Bruce and Kate Wollstein, Lacey; Elliot Moon, Bonney Lake; Beth and David Lahrmeyer, Gig Harbor; Caroline, Rob, Zack, Kade, Elly and Luciene Kunkel, Pullman; Joanne and Pat Corrigan Bellevue, and Jim Appel, Seattle.

Lisa, Travis, Miriam, Rachel, Emma and Colette Frei, Palouse, and Mark Appel and Jamie Hughes, Colfax, came to help with butchering later in the week.

Dick and Helen Appel are grandparents once again. Susan and Joe Lynch have a daughter, Cecilia Grace, born Dec. 29 in West Lafayette, Ind.

Wes and Jen Claassen and children drove to Kansas City for Christmas at Jennifer’s brother’s house with 21 family members joining in the celebration. They attended a Chiefs vs. Colts football game and spent two weeks with family. After spending Christmas in Kansas City, they went on to visit Jen’s parents in Branson where they spent a few days visiting and took in the Spirit of Christmas Show before driving back home.

Dick and Suzy McNeilly travelled back east to celebrate Suzy’s son, Jacob and his wife Ashley’s, New Year’s Eve wedding celebration. They were joined by all three of Suzy’s children and five grandchildren. While there, they toured Fredericksburg, Va., and Washington, D.C.

Lucky and Joan Myrick celebrated a late Christmas with their children and their families last week. Mike Myrick, Tacoma, and his son Michael, Yelm, and Rhonda Cluff, Tacoma, arrived Thursday and stayed until Saturday. Rich Myrick and Jannetta Johnson, Moses Lake, arrived Friday and stayed until Sunday. They all were joined by Rob Myrick and Larry and Di Brink Saturday for Christmas dinner.

Loren Scaggs, Dusty, and Beth Christie, Buffalo, N.Y., spent New Year’s snowmobiling at Priest Lake. They stayed at Hills Resort with Stan and Kyle and Lisa Hawley of Moscow; Penny of Moscow, and her sister Pam of Los Angeles.

Renee Horton and her 16-year-old daughter Devin of Houston spent from New Year’s Eve to Monday visiting with Renee’s parents, Warren and Connie Horton.

Karen Broeckel joined Oscar Broeckel, Brian and Angela Broeckel, Doreen Riedner and Denise Kendall at their family dinner last week. Both Riedner and Kendall returned to their respective homes in Genesee and Tacoma last Thursday.

Dusty BB Club met Wednesday in the parrish hall of St. Joseph’s Catholic Church in LaCrosse to make baby blankets for the free maternity clinic at Sacred Heart Hospital in Spokane. Hostesses were Janelle Guske and Diane Monson. Roll call was snow memories.
